π§΅ Protective Cap vs. Insulating Cover vs. Solar Blanket: What’s the Difference?
One of the most common points of confusion for new spa owners is assuming that “cover,” “cap,” and “blanket” all describe the same object. In reality, a properly protected hot tub relies on up to three distinct layers, each doing a completely different job. Understanding where a protective cap fits into that stack is the key to knowing whether you actually need one, and which style suits your setup.
π Solar Blanket / Thermal Layer
Floats directly on the water’s surface, beneath the hard cover or inflatable lid. Its job is to slow evaporation and reduce the chemical off-gassing that eats away at the underside of your main cover. It touches water directly and typically needs replacing every one to two seasons.
π‘οΈ Insulating Cover
The rigid, foam-core cover (or inflatable lid) that sits on top of your spa. This is your primary heat-retention barrier and, in many jurisdictions, the component that satisfies child-safety and drowning-prevention requirements. It never touches the water directly.
βοΈ Protective Cap
The outermost shell reviewed in this guide. It never contacts water or foam at all β its entire purpose is to intercept UV rays, rain, snow, and debris before they can reach and degrade the insulating cover underneath.
Think of it the way you’d think about layers of clothing in cold weather. The solar blanket is your base layer, trapping warmth close to the source. The insulating cover is the heavy coat doing the bulk of the thermal work. The protective cap is the waterproof shell jacket worn over the coat β it doesn’t add much warmth on its own, but without it, the coat underneath would be soaked, sun-bleached, and falling apart within a season or two. Skipping the shell layer doesn’t save you money in the long run; it just moves the cost from a $40β$80 cap purchase now to a $300β$600 cover replacement later.
A frequent misconception is that owners with a “quality” vinyl cover don’t need a cap because the marine-grade vinyl is already UV-treated. UV-resistant vinyl slows degradation, it doesn’t stop it. Constant, unbroken sun exposure β the kind a stationary hot tub receives every single day, all year β will eventually break down even the best marine-grade coatings. A protective cap doesn’t replace the quality of your primary cover; it multiplies its usable lifespan by taking the brunt of the exposure so the vinyl underneath only has to deal with ambient temperature swings, not direct radiation and standing water.

A cap that’s too small won’t seat over the corners of your insulating cover, leaving gaps where wind and rain sneak in. A cap that’s too large will flap in the wind, chafe against the vinyl underneath, and eventually work its straps loose. Getting the sizing right the first time saves you a return shipment and a second week of unprotected exposure while you wait on a replacement. Here’s the process professional installers use.
Step 1: Measure the Installed Cover, Not the Cabinet
Always take measurements from the outer edge of your installed insulating cover, not the hot tub’s cabinet or shell. Covers typically overhang the cabinet by one to three inches on each side, and that overhang is exactly what the cap needs to wrap around. Measuring the cabinet alone will consistently produce a cap that’s too tight.
Step 2: Choose the Right Measurement Method for Your Shape
- **Round spas:** Measure the diameter of the cover at its widest point, corner to corner across the center. Take two measurements at slightly different angles and use the larger figure.
- **Square spas:** Measure each of the four sides independently along the outer edge of the cover. Square covers are rarely perfectly symmetrical after a season of use, so don’t assume all four sides match.
- **Rectangular spas:** Measure the long side (length) and short side (width) separately, then measure diagonally from corner to corner as a cross-check. A rectangular cap that’s sized only from length and width, without checking the diagonal, can end up pulling too tight at the corners.
Step 3: Measure Corner Radius on Rounded-Corner Models
Many square and rectangular covers have softly rounded rather than sharp 90-degree corners. Lay a straightedge along each side of the corner and measure the distance from where the fabric starts to curve to where it becomes flat again. This radius measurement is what separates a cap that seats flush at the corners from one that bunches or gaps there β the same detail that hard-cover manufacturers rely on when producing custom-fit covers.
Step 4: Account for Skirt (Drop) Length
The skirt is the portion of the cap that hangs down over the sides of your spa cabinet. A longer skirt protects more of the cabinet from splash damage, staining, and pest intrusion, but it also means more fabric flapping in high wind if the strap system is weak. As a general rule, an 8β12 inch skirt is sufficient for most residential installs, while spas in high-wind or coastal areas benefit from cap models with reinforced strap points along a longer skirt.
Step 5: Note Any Obstructions
Cover lifter arms, locking brackets, and side-mounted control panels can all interfere with a snug cap fit. Measure the height these obstructions add above the cover’s surface, and check a given cap’s product listing or customer photos for confirmation that it accommodates lifter hardware β this is one of the most common sources of “surprise” return requests.

π§ The Ultimate Protective Cover Buying Guide: Don’t Buy Until You Read This!
Selecting the best protective cover cap requires a methodical approach, much like debugging a complex application. We must break down the key components to understand where the real value lies. Forget about marketing and focus on the **Big Three**: Material Strength (Denier), Water Resistance (Coating), and Secure Fit (Fasteners). The protective cap is the shield that preserves your primary insulating cover from premature breakdown, which is primarily caused by UV exposure and environmental debris. Compromise here, and you compromise the lifespan of your entire spa system.
1. Material Strength: Understanding the Denier Rating
The Denier (D) rating is critical. It measures the linear mass density of the fibers used to weave the fabric. In simple terms: **A higher Denier means a thicker, heavier, and more durable thread, leading to a stronger, more tear-resistant fabric.**
- **600D:** The gold standard. Offers superior strength for areas with heavy debris, high winds, or frequent handling. It’s the most durable against punctures and tearing.
- **400D/420D:** The excellent value standard. Provides strong UV and weather protection while remaining lightweight and easy to fold. Perfect for daily use.
- **210D (or similar low-denier):** Budget-friendly and extremely light. Best for indoor spas, backup use, or moderate climates where only light dust and UV protection are needed.

The base fabric is only half the story; the coating is what makes the cover waterproof:
- **PU (Polyurethane) Coating:** Common on 400D/420D covers. It’s flexible, lightweight, and provides good water repellency. Over time, it can break down with constant UV exposure.
- **PVC (Polyvinyl Chloride) Coating:** Used on 600D and commercial-grade covers. It is a heavier, rubber-like sealant that creates an almost impenetrable barrier, making the cover truly 100% waterproof and highly effective for winter storage.

The fastening system is what actually keeps your cap in place once it’s installed, and it matters just as much as the fabric itself β a top-tier 600D fabric with a weak fastener will still blow loose in a strong gust.
- **Buckle straps:** The most secure option. Adjustable, quick-release buckles let you dial in precise tension and hold that tension reliably over months of exposure. Best suited to caps that stay installed long-term, and essential for rectangular or oversized covers with long, flat edges.
- **Drawstring hems:** A simpler, lighter-weight solution that cinches the cap around the base like a garbage bag tie. Effective in mild-to-moderate wind, but the tension can loosen gradually over weeks and needs periodic re-cinching.
- **Elastic hems with toggles:** Offer a “set it and forget it” fit that self-adjusts slightly with temperature changes, at the cost of slightly less maximum tension than a buckle system. A good middle-ground choice for owners who value convenience over the absolute highest wind resistance.
For most residential installations in areas without sustained high winds, any of these three systems will perform adequately. The decision becomes more important in exposed, elevated, or coastal locations, where we’d always recommend prioritizing a buckle-strap design or a dual-securement system (buckles plus a drawstring) over a single fastening method.
4. Climate-Specific Selection: Matching Your Cap to Your Environment
There’s no single “best” cap independent of where you live β the ideal choice depends heavily on which environmental stressor your region throws at your spa most often.
- **Hot, sun-heavy climates (Southwest, Florida, Southern California):** Prioritize UV-stabilized fabric and solution-dyed fibers over raw denier. A lighter cap with strong fade resistance, like our fade-resistant pick, often outperforms a thicker but untreated fabric here.
- **Cold, snowy climates (Northeast, Mountain West, Midwest):** Prioritize PVC coating and higher denier for load-bearing strength under accumulated snow, plus cold-tolerant material that won’t crack at fold lines during winter storage.
- **Wet, humid climates (Pacific Northwest, Gulf Coast, Southeast):** Prioritize ventilated designs that prevent condensation buildup, since sealed caps in constantly humid air are more prone to trapping moisture and encouraging mildew growth underneath.
- **Windy or coastal locations:** Prioritize dual-fastening systems (buckles plus drawstring) and reinforced corner stitching, regardless of denier rating, since fastener failure β not fabric failure β is the most common cause of cap loss in high-wind areas.
5. Compatibility with Cover Lifters and Lift Systems
If your spa uses a cover lifter β the hinged arm system that helps raise and lower a heavy insulating cover β your protective cap needs to accommodate that hardware without binding or tearing. Look for product listings or reviews that specifically mention lifter compatibility, and where possible, choose a cap with a slightly deeper skirt on the side where the lifter arm attaches. Owners who skip this check sometimes find themselves forcing the cap over lifter brackets, which stresses seams at exactly the point where they’re most likely to tear. If your current cap doesn’t clear your lifter hardware, a simple workaround is temporarily folding the lifter arm flat against the cabinet wall before securing the cap, rather than leaving it in the raised position.
6. Cost and Return-on-Investment Analysis
A quality protective cap typically costs between $30 and $90 depending on size, denier, and brand. Compare that to the cost of a replacement insulating cover, which commonly runs $250 to $600 depending on size and insulation level. If a cap extends your insulating cover’s usable life by even two extra years β a conservative estimate based on the UV and moisture protection it provides β it will have paid for itself several times over well before that cover would otherwise need replacing. Factor in the additional savings from reduced heat loss (a cover that isn’t cracked or waterlogged retains heat far more efficiently) and the ROI case for a protective cap becomes difficult to argue against for any spa that lives outdoors year-round.
β οΈ Common Installation Mistakes That Shorten Your Cap’s Lifespan
Even the best protective cap can underperform if it’s installed or used incorrectly. These are the mistakes we see most often, and they’re all avoidable once you know what to look for.
- **Leaving straps loose “for convenience”:** A loosely fitted cap flaps in the wind, which chafes against the vinyl cover underneath and wears through fabric at friction points far faster than a properly tensioned installation.
- **Ignoring water pooling in the center:** Flat-installed caps without a slight peak or dome will collect standing water, which stresses seams over time and can eventually saturate through to the cover below.
- **Installing over a wet or dirty cover:** Sealing moisture, dirt, or organic debris underneath the cap creates a closed, damp environment that actively encourages mold and mildew growth rather than preventing it.
- **Forcing the cap over lifter hardware:** Pushing fabric over brackets or hinge arms it wasn’t sized for concentrates stress at a single point, which is the most common cause of early seam tears near the strap attachments.
- **Folding heavy-duty fabric along the same crease repeatedly:** Always vary your fold pattern slightly between installations. Repeatedly folding along an identical line weakens the coating at that crease and eventually cracks the waterproof backing.
- **Skipping the mid-season inspection:** A quick monthly check of strap tension and seam condition catches small issues β a loosening buckle, a fraying stitch β while they’re still a five-minute fix rather than a full replacement.
- **Storing the cap wet:** Folding and bagging a damp cap for off-season storage traps moisture against the fabric, which is one of the fastest ways to introduce mildew odor and staining before the next season even starts.
βοΈ Seasonal Usage Guide: Adapting Your Cap Strategy Year-Round
A protective cap isn’t a “set it and forget it” purchase β how you use it should shift slightly with the seasons to get the most protection out of it.
Spring
Spring is the ideal time for a full inspection after winter’s wear. Check for any UV fading, seam stress, or strap wear that accumulated over the colder months, and give the cap a thorough clean before the high-use summer season begins. This is also the best window to reapply a water-repellent treatment, since the cap will see heavy use and exposure over the coming months.
Summer
Summer typically means more frequent cap removal for regular spa use, so prioritize convenience: a lighter denier cap with quick-release fasteners will save real time if you’re taking it on and off several times a week. This is also peak UV season, so make sure any fade-resistant treatment is still active, and avoid leaving the cap balled up in direct sun when not installed, since a folded cap left on hot concrete degrades faster than one installed and airing normally.
Fall
Falling leaves and debris make fall the season where a well-fitted skirt and sealed seams matter most. Clear leaf litter off the top of the cap regularly rather than letting it accumulate and hold moisture against the fabric, and inspect drainage β a cap that’s developed a slight sag will start collecting standing water exactly when soggy leaves are falling into it.
Winter
Winter calls for your heaviest-duty, most weather-resistant cap installed and left in place for the season, rather than daily removal. Brush off accumulated snow regularly rather than letting it build to a heavy load, since excess weight stresses seams and strap points over an extended period. If your climate sees hard freezes, avoid removing and refolding the cap in extreme cold, since stiffened fabric and PVC coatings are more prone to cracking when manipulated at low temperatures β wait for a milder day if adjustments are needed.

If you remove your cap entirely during an off-season rather than leaving it installed, always ensure it’s completely dry before folding and storing it. Store it in a breathable bag rather than a fully sealed plastic bin, since trapped residual moisture in an airtight container is one of the fastest routes to a mildew smell that’s difficult to fully remove later. A cool, dry space out of direct sunlight β a garage shelf or storage bench β is ideal. Avoid storing anything heavy on top of a folded cap, since sustained compression at the same fold lines over months can weaken the coating exactly where it’s already under the most stress.
4. Signs Your Protective Cap Needs Replacement
Watch for these indicators that it’s time to retire your current cap rather than keep patching it: visible cracking or flaking in the coating, especially along fold lines; water soaking through to the touch rather than beading on the surface; strap or buckle hardware that no longer holds tension even at maximum adjustment; noticeable fading accompanied by a change in fabric texture (a sign UV has begun breaking down the fiber itself, not just the dye); and any tear longer than a couple of inches, since small tears in load-bearing fabric spread quickly under continued wind stress. Catching these signs early and replacing the cap proactively is almost always cheaper than waiting for a failure that exposes your insulating cover to unprotected weather in the meantime.
β Frequently Asked Questions
Do I really need a protective cap if I already have a good insulating cover?
Yes, if your spa is outdoors and exposed to sun or weather for extended periods. Even UV-treated marine-grade vinyl degrades under constant, unbroken sun exposure. A protective cap intercepts that exposure so your insulating cover only has to deal with temperature swings, not direct radiation and standing water.
How long does a hot tub protective cap typically last?
A quality 600D cap with proper maintenance typically lasts three to five years. Lighter 400D-420D caps generally last two to four years, while budget 210D options may need replacing after one to two seasons of heavy use.
Can I leave a protective cap on year-round?
Yes, for most heavy-duty models this is exactly how they’re designed to be used. Just make sure the design includes ventilation or you periodically air out the space underneath to prevent condensation buildup, and check strap tension seasonally.
What’s the difference between 400D, 420D, and 600D fabric?
The number refers to the Denier rating, or thread density. Higher numbers mean thicker, stronger, more tear-resistant threads. 600D offers the highest abrasion resistance, while 400D/420D options balance strength with lighter weight for easier daily handling.
Will a protective cap fit over my cover lifter?
Most standard caps will fit around basic lifter arms if the lifter is folded flat before installation. Check the specific product listing for lifter compatibility, and consider a model with a deeper skirt on the lifter side if you have a bulkier lift system.
How do I stop water from pooling on top of my cap?
Place a cover dome or air pillow underneath the cap to create a slight peak, which lets rain and snow run off the sides instead of collecting in the center. Regularly brushing off standing water after storms also helps.
Should I choose a round or square/rectangular cap?
Match the shape to your spa’s insulating cover, not the cabinet. Measure the outer edge of your installed cover at its widest points, including any overhang, to determine the correct shape and size.
Can a protective cap replace my insulating cover entirely?
No. A protective cap is not designed for heat retention or child-safety compliance the way an insulating cover is. It’s an outer shell meant to protect your insulating cover, not a substitute for one.
How do I clean mildew off a protective cap?
Use a mild soap and soft brush, never harsh detergents or bleach, which can break down waterproof coatings. Rinse thoroughly and let the cap dry completely in open air before reinstalling or storing it.
Is a heavier denier always better?
Not necessarily. Heavier denier means more abrasion resistance but also more weight and bulk to handle. If your primary concern is UV fade in a sunny climate rather than physical debris or heavy snow, a lighter cap with strong UV treatment can outperform an untreated heavier one.
